Kevin is former Co-chair of Morrison Foerster’s Government Contracts & Public Procurement practice. Kevin has broad experience in numerous facets of government contracts matters including agency procurements, subcontracting, teaming and joint venture relationships, contract performance issues, intellectual property, compliance matters, due diligence for mergers and acquisitions, and procurement fraud matters. He represents clients in the preparation and litigation of contract adjustment claims and terminations for both government contracts and construction projects. Over the course of his 30-year career, Kevin has handled more than 300 bid protest cases, representing both protesters and contract awardees before the U.S. Government Accountability Office, the U.S. Court of Federal Claims, federal district courts, and state protest forums.

Kevin is active in the Public Contract Law Section of the American Bar Association, where he has served as a Co-Chair of the Contract Claims and Disputes Resolution Committee and the Bid Protest Committee, and a Vice-Chair of the Acquisition Reform and Emerging Issues Committee, as well as a member of the Section’s Council and its Interim Membership Director. He also served on the Board of Governors of the U.S. Court of Federal Claims Bar Association.
